Lg headers, Halltech and tune.
Went to LG motorsports yesterday and got the above installed,
I talked to Anthony today @ LG, he said 415 on torque was a spike from the converter.
The readings are Hp 342.2 to 368.7, TQ 342.5 to 371. I can feel a difference in the way the car takes off.
